What are Linear Bar Grilles?

Linear bar grilles are architectural air diffusers characterized by their long, narrow design and a series of evenly spaced bars or vanes. They are typically constructed from aluminum, steel, or other durable materials, often featuring a powder-coated finish for enhanced corrosion resistance and visual appeal. Available in various lengths, depths, and finishes, linear bar grilles can be tailored to match specific design requirements and blend seamlessly with any interior aesthetic.

How do Linear Bar Grilles Work?

Linear bar grilles function by directing and distributing conditioned air from the HVAC system into the occupied space. The arrangement and angle of the bars or vanes within the grille determine the airflow pattern, velocity, and throw. This precise control over air distribution ensures optimal comfort and ventilation while minimizing drafts and stagnant air pockets.

Where are Linear Bar Grilles Commonly Used?

The versatility of linear bar grilles makes them suitable for a wide range of applications, including:

  • Commercial spaces: offices, retail stores, restaurants, hotels
  • Residential buildings: apartments, condominiums, modern homes
  • Institutional facilities: schools, hospitals, government buildings

Their sleek design is particularly well-suited for modern and contemporary interiors, blending seamlessly with drywall ceilings, suspended ceilings, and exposed ductwork.

What are Installation Best Practices for Linear Bar Grilles?

Proper installation is crucial for optimal performance and aesthetics. Here are some best practices to consider:

  • Ensure accurate measurements and alignment with the ceiling or wall surface.
  • Use appropriate mounting methods and hardware recommended by the manufacturer.
  • Seal any gaps or openings around the grille to prevent air leakage and noise.
  • Regularly clean or replace filters to maintain optimal airflow and air quality.
